We would like to move to Estonia to start an environmentally friendly camp site. How complicated are the rules for being self employed out there?
Anonymous (not verified) on 2 Jun 2016 - 15:13
Hi floss,

Although Estonia is not yet a popular expat destination, the country presents some good entrepreneurial opportunities. 

Where will you be moving from?

EU nationals are able to work in Estonia without a work permit, but need to obtain a residency permit within 30 days of arrival in the country.
